John, you could install *Psensor. *With it, you can see "%CPU usage" for the last ten minutes. Another possibility is *System Load Indicator* which sits nicely in your top panel but I can't figure out how much "back" it displays . Something more elaborate like *Conky* is also available. All are in the Ubuntu Software Center.
